UPVC Door Crack Repair: A Comprehensive Guide
UPVC (Unplasticized Polyvinyl Chloride) doors are popular for their toughness, weather condition resistance, and low maintenance requirements. However, like any material, they can develop fractures in time, which can compromise their appearance and performance. It's important to deal with these issues immediately to guarantee the longevity of your door and keep your home's security. Finding cracks early is vital to prevent escalation. Here's how to identify potential issues:
Visual Inspection: Regularly examine your door for any noticeable fractures, especially in high-stress areas such as hinges and edges.
Touch Test: Run your hand along the surface area to feel for any abnormalities that might show surprise damage.
Practical Test: Open and close the door to look for any indications of sticking or breakdown. If the door feels misaligned, it's a signal that there might be underlying damage.
Repair Methods for UPVC Door Cracks
When your UPVC door develops cracks, a number of repair methods can be used, depending upon the intensity of the damage.
1. Short-lived Fixes
These can assist till a more long-term option is discovered.
Adhesive Tape: Use strong adhesive tape over small cracks as a momentary procedure.
Epoxy Putty: For minor fractures, use epoxy putty. Form it into the shape of the crack before it dries.
2. DIY Solutions
For those who choose dealing with repairs personally, here are some DIY methods:

Clean the Affected Area: Use a cleaner to eliminate dirt and debris.
Prepare the Crack: If the crack is large, widen the leading a little with a knife to ensure the filler adheres well.
Apply Epoxy Resin: Mix and use the epoxy into the crack using a putty knife. Smooth the surface for an even surface.
Enable to Cure: Let the epoxy fully set according to the producer's instructions.
Sand and Paint: Once treated, sand the area lightly, then retouch with paint if needed.

Taking steps to prevent fractures can conserve money and time. Here are some pointers:
Regular Maintenance: Regularly clean and oil door hinges and locks.
Temperature level Control: Ensure steady indoor temperature levels where possible to minimize drastic modifications.
Avoid Slamming: Encourage member of the family to close doors gently to decrease effect damage.
Examine Regularly: A regular check can assist capture any early indications of damage.
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ION1. Can I paint my UPVC door after fixing it?
Yes, as soon as the repair is total and completely cured, you can paint your UPVC Patio Door Repair door. Utilize a paint specifically developed for UPVC surface areas to make sure an excellent surface and adhesion.
2. For how long do repairs require to treat?
The curing time differs based on the item utilized, but a lot of epoxy resins take about 24 hours to fully set. Constantly follow the maker's standards for finest results.
3. What should I do if the crack is too huge to fill?
If the crack is substantial, it may be best to speak with a professional for repair or replacement of the affected panel.
4. Are there any DIY kits available for UPVC door repair?
Yes, various DIY repair kits are available that come with all necessary materials and instructions for small to medium repairs.
5. Can I change just the UPVC panel if it's split?
Yes, oftentimes, you can replace simply the harmed panel instead of the whole door. Nevertheless, consult a professional to identify the finest alternative for your circumstance.
